Planning appeal decision

Dismissed6 October 20233315675

6A Shardeloes Road, London, SE14 6NZ

a retrospective application for the continued use of a studio/micro flat

Authority
London Borough of Lewisham
Appeal type
minor · Planning Appeal
Procedure
Written Representations
Development
residential · Change of use
Inspector
Lo S

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• whether the appeal site is in an appropriate location for the proposed development
  • whether the proposed development would provide acceptable living conditions for future occupiers, having particular regard to floor space and external amenity space
  • whether or not satisfactory arrangements for the storage of cycles has been demonstrated
  • whether or not satisfactory arrangements for the storage and collection of refuse has been demonstrated

What decided it

The proposed development conflicts with development plan policy on multiple grounds—loss of employment use, inadequate living conditions, and lack of cycle and refuse storage—with no material considerations demonstrated to outweigh these conflicts.
